Leopold Fonck was a notable figure in biblical scholarship, particularly known for his works on the interpretation of the scriptures. His writing reflects a deep commitment to elucidating the teachings of the Gospel, making complex theological concepts accessible to a broader audience. He aimed to bridge the gap between academic theology and the practical application of biblical principles in everyday life.

Among his notable publications is "The Parables of the Gospel," which provides an exegetical and practical explanation of the parables found in the New Testament. This work demonstrates his ability to engage with scripture in a way that resonates with both scholars and laypeople alike. Fonck's contributions to the field have influenced many subsequent theologians and scholars, solidifying his place in the landscape of biblical literature.
